COMPANY DIVIDENDS

Mortgage and Agency Company of New Zealand. Ltd.: Subject to approval by shareholders at the annual meeting in London on April 22, a dividend will be paid at the rate of 5 per cent, per annum for the year ended September 30, 1946, of which 2* per cent, has already boon paid together with a bonus of U per cent, actual. making a total of 61 per cent, for the year (unchanged). The Dominion register of shares will be closed from April 9 to April 22, both days inclusive. The dividend will be paid on receipt of cabled advice of the result of the annual meeting, and will be payable at the National Bank of New Zealand. London. Advice to this effect has been received by the Stock Exchange Association of New Zealand. Auckland Laundry. Ltd. is recommending a lower dividend of 3 per cent, for the year ended January 31. Dividend for the previous three years was 4 per cent, the rote being raised from the 3 per cent, paid for the year ended January 31, 1943.
